The ten we would buy first
1. Dallas 100 Ankle Boots in Black Suede, $1,330
The Texan boot, in black suede. The shape the house is known for, on a 100 mm covered block that walks like a 70, and the boot that goes with everything in the wardrobe.
2. El Dorado 100 Boots in Angora Suede, $1,680
The Texan knee-high, in pale suede. Angora is the palest Texan in stock and the nearest in spirit to the white boot on the Cowboy Carter cover; wear it with black in winter and white in summer.
3. Lidia 70 Mules in Black Patent Leather, $1,150
The Lidia mule at 70 mm, in black patent. The pointed toe at the height you can wear all day, and the first pair for anyone who does not want a boot.
4. Lidia 105 Mules in Black Patent Leather, $1,150
The Lidia mule at 105 mm, the original. The evening version of number three, and the shoe that made the label’s name on the street-style circuit.
5. Lidia 105 Slingbacks in Black Patent Leather, $1,240
The slingback for the office. The Lidia that stays on, in black patent at 105 mm; the 70 mm version is the same at a working height.
6. Stiletto 105 Boots in Black Nappa Leather, $1,590
The Stiletto boot. The knee-high in black nappa on a croc-embossed 105 mm heel, for a mini skirt and a long coat.
7. Lidia 105 Mules in Gold Mirrored Leather, $1,240
The party shoe. The Lidia 105 in gold mirrored leather, the pair that replaces jewellery.
8. Anja 85 Ankle Boots in Cioccolato Suede, $1,150
The ankle boot for every day. The Anja 85 in Cioccolato suede, on a covered block, in the brown that goes with everything black does.
9. Bettina 25 Ankle Boots in Black Leather, $1,150
The flat boot. The Bettina 25 in black calf, with lateral elastic bands, for walking days.
10. Bettina 50 Winter Ankle Boots in Black and Natural Leather and Shearling, $1,680
The winter pair. The Bettina 50 lined in ivory shearling, worn folded over.

How to shop it
Decide the heel first, then the shape, then the colour. The 70 mm Lidia and the 60 to 85 mm block boots are the all-day pairs; the 105 mm Lidia and the Stiletto 105 are for evenings. Black first, Rouge Noir and Ebano second, the nudes and the mirror for summer and parties. Every style fits true to size; round up a half on the pointed toe, down on the pull-on Texan if your foot is narrow. “Paris Texas is the perfect fusion between two worlds and this duality is expressed in the brand’s name itself, where Parisian chic sensuality meets the fearless audacity of Texan cowboys,” Annamaria Brivio told Footwear News in March 2024, adding that “for Paris Texas the Western style is an attitude and not a trend, it is part of our DNA.”
